Output e576a66a87d1cc13cff5bbd076023f57a6c9a6b1a5f7ba1ae500d10ec628877d:1

value
17432690
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e6d19344a1b907fb882f94f692d71a88938eb3c8 OP_EQUALVERIFY OP_CHECKSIG
address
LgGQjsvSX6sE1odgUedv4c3XtpZTZyAFGQ
transaction
e576a66a87d1cc13cff5bbd076023f57a6c9a6b1a5f7ba1ae500d10ec628877d
spent
true